To create an exact copy of the sculpture, the volume of material they must purchase is [tex]8\,\text{f}{{\text{t}}^{3}}[/tex].
What is the volume of a cuboid?
The volume of a cuboid is calculated by multiplying its length, width, and height.
The length and width of the triangle are identical since the base is a square.
[tex]L = W = 2\,{\text{ft, and }}H = 6\,{\text{ft}}[/tex]
Knows the volume of material he must purchase,
[tex]\text{Volume}=\frac{\text{Height}\times \text{length}\times \text{width}}{3}[/tex]
So,
[tex]\Rightarrow \text{Volume}&=\frac{2\times 2\times 6}{3} \\\Rightarrow \text{Volume}&=2\times 2\times 2\,\text{f}{{\text{t}}^{3}} \\ \Rightarrow \text{Volume}&=8\,\text{f}{{\text{t}}^{3}} \\[/tex]
Therefore, the volume of material they must purchase is [tex]8\,\text{f}{{\text{t}}^{3}}[/tex].
